Date: December 23, 2009
Dear Valued Customer:
Effective December 30th, 2009, Amerijet International, Inc. will adjust the maximum liability from 17 SDR/kg to 19 SDR/kg in accordance with the Montreal Convention 1999.
Amerijet International, Inc. will distribute new air waybills once our existing stock has been depleted. Regardless of the wording of the existing air waybill stock, all justified claims for shipments received on or after December 30th, 2009 will be handled according to the new limit of 19 SDR/kg.
